Title: Will Snoop bring the West Coast back?
Post by: Ste-V 187 on July 30, 2006, 06:14:46 AM
First off, I know I ain't posted on this site for a long time/at all but I felt I had to speak on Snoop after reading his interviews.

The question I am putting is whether people really think the west coast can be brought back by Snoop, or can it be brought back at all?

On the point of Snoop. Clearly he is trying to show love for the west coast by shouting out homies, doing collaborations and making groups. I think most substantially this appointment as president of Koch West (although I am not sure its finalised) is most substantial. In my opinion Western Union are weak and the modern rap fans look not only at lyrics but beats. I think the beats are weak as well. They clearly aren't the future of the west coast and I personally don't rate them one bit. Warzone is more promising but I fear that they will fail for 3 reasons.

1. Again in my view the beats are fairly weak.

2. I think MC Eight is dare I say a little washed up and Goldie Loc has missed his chance. I got love for Kam though but I think to really bring him on fire he needs Paris beats and that sought of political edge. Crooked I would have been a dope edition.

3. Snoop is not a business man and doesn't know how to put a album together on his own. I back this point up with the Cali Is Active album. The lead single was the dopest shit I have heard for years. But mixing that up with bland attempts at East and Southern music just made the album shit. I think Daz and Kurupt are still hot and its a shame that they aren't getting out there.

I think the idea of a Koch West is good. Snoop isn't a good at business but a he will have a management structure behind him. So bring out B-Real etc. that way.

On the wider view of the west coast I am begining to fear that it won't be coming back. Raps golden era has gone and I worry that the Souths time is really a sign rap is morphing into a new pop genre. I think also latin music will be come far more dominant because of their socioeconomic circumstances and there sheer population (e.g. Omar Cruz and the wider Reggaeton). I hope I am wrong as Bishop Lamont, Crooked I and possibly Glasses Malone, Planet Asia and Diego Redd could go places. Unfortuntaly the only man who can bring them out is Dr. Dre. Hopefully a new genius of this sought will emerge as Dre won't be around for ever.

Post by: Jakubs on July 30, 2006, 08:56:42 PM
I think Dre will bring the west back if anyone is going to do it. The last time the west was in the spotlight was when Dre dropped 2001 back in '99. We had Snoop drop 3 albums in 3 years with No Limit, the last of which was the best one, The Last Meal. Xzibit had Restless, and to top it off Dre was all over both of those records. Dre will put the spotlight back on the west when he drops Detox, and then it's just a matter of other west coast artists to release quality material at the same time to keep the buzz going.
